US Newspapers Sue Bloggers and Bulletin Boards
It is well known that the news industry is in crisis and is fighting for its survival in the internet age. Facing the competition of free information on 'the web', the industry is trying to come up with new business models. Some put the emphasis on the value added by 'real' journalists in an attempt to justify the cost of newspapers' information. Others think of alternative platforms and new markets for the press (for example iPad, tablets and other mobile devices). Some argue that the public now prefers low cost unverified and un-authenticated news rather than verified, filtered and analyzed news.
